About Banking & Finance Law in Belgrade, Serbia:
Belgrade, the capital of Serbia, has a well-developed banking and financial sector. The banking system in Belgrade is regulated by various laws and regulations to ensure stability and protect consumers. The field of Banking & Finance law in Belgrade covers a wide range of legal matters related to banking transactions, financial institutions, investment activities, and consumer protection.

Local Laws Overview:
There are several key aspects of local laws that are particularly relevant to Banking & Finance in Belgrade, Serbia:
- The Law on Banks regulates the establishment, operation, and supervision of banks in Belgrade.
- The Law on Financial Contracts regulates various aspects of financial contracts, including loan agreements, derivatives, and securities.
- The Law on Securities and Stock Exchange regulates the issuance, trading, and disclosure of securities in Belgrade.
- The Law on Consumer Protection provides protection to consumers in their transactions with banks and financial institutions.
- The Law on Prevention of Money Laundering and Financing of Terrorism imposes obligations on banks and financial institutions to prevent money laundering and terrorist financing.
Frequently Asked Questions:
Q: What are the requirements for opening a bank account in Belgrade, Serbia?
A: To open a bank account in Belgrade, Serbia, you generally need to provide identification documents, proof of address, and sometimes additional documents depending on the bank's requirements.
Q: Can I take legal action against a bank if I believe they have treated me unfairly?
A: Yes, if you believe you have been treated unfairly by a bank or financial institution in Belgrade, you can take legal action. It is advisable to consult with a lawyer to understand your rights and options.
Q: What are the laws regarding mortgage loans in Belgrade, Serbia?
A: Mortgage loans in Belgrade are regulated by various laws, including the Law on Financial Contracts and the Law on Real Estate. These laws govern the terms, conditions, and legal rights and obligations of borrowers and lenders in mortgage loan transactions.
Q: Are there any specific legal requirements for financial institutions in Belgrade?
A: Yes, financial institutions in Belgrade are subject to various legal requirements, including licensing by the Serbian National Bank, compliance with financial regulations, capital adequacy requirements, and anti-money laundering obligations.
